  • Patent number: 11990265
    Abstract: A multilayer coil component includes an element body that includes a plurality of insulating layers laminated together, a coil that is embedded in the element body and that includes a coil conductor layer provided between the insulating layers, and a first outer electrode and a second outer electrode each of which is provided on at least one of outer surfaces of the element body and each of which is electrically connected to the coil. A dissimilar-material layer that is made of a material different from the insulating layers is provided on at least one of the outer surfaces of the element body that extend in a lamination direction in which the plurality of insulating layers are laminated together.

  • Publication number: 20100047506
    Abstract: The present invention can record or reproduce information in a stable manner with a simple configuration. According to the present invention, since a photoinitiator whose vaporization temperature is between 140 and 400 deg C. is included, a portion around a focal point Fb of a recording optical beam L2c heats up after the recording optical beam L2c is focused, vaporizing the photoinitiator. As a result, an air bubble is formed. This air bubble is left in a recording layer 101 as a cavity after the emission of the recording optical beam L2c ends and the portion around the focal point Fb cools down. When a reading optical beam L2d is emitted, the air bubble can reflect the reading optical beam L2d due to the difference in refractive index between a portion inside the air bubble and the portion outside the air bubble (i.e. the recording layer 101), producing a returning optical beam L3.
